Zebra Capital Management's HE Position: Q2 2017 in Review
Zebra Capital Management sold out of Hawaiian Electric Industries (HE) in Q2 2017, closing a stake of 21,045 shares — an estimated $701K sold.
Zebra Capital Management first reported a position in HE in Q1 2014 and held it in 5 quarters. The position peaked at $1.53M in Q3 2014. 246 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old HE as of Q2 2017.
